I am looking to find a home for a temp staffing agency in CT. It is about $110,000 in premium and has a 1.37MOD. They have mostly "main street" class codes. PEO is not an option. Most brokers are having a tough time placing because one of their exposures is garbage hauling. Anyone have a suggestions???

There are few good staffing programs around. While we write Peo's and Staffing in the Southern States, we do not write them in CT. You can try Staffing lines for this CT based employer. Staffing Lines is a product offered through NSM Insurance Group.

They are good people with a strong product. And of course it is a true workers' compensation policy with the insured's name in item 1A.
